Fish Personality


Although many people consider fish to be boring animals, who can only amuse us with the colors of their bodies and the shapes they leave in the water, let me tell you that they are very wrong. Like cats and dogs fish also have a personality which can be more daring and aggressive depending on the water conditions.

According to different scientific research carried out, it has been seen that fish can be much more daring and aggressive if we increase the temperature of the water, it has even been discovered that they can suffer, like us humans and other animals, from something very similar to the depression. 

For example, after having performed different types of experiments with two types of species of Great Barrier Reef Damsel of the Oceanic continent, it was discovered for the first time that some fish of these species, which are characterized by being quite shy, have presented individual differences as the water temperature has increased, that is, they have become much more daring and aggressive with the heating of the water.

In this way, when the temperature has risen a couple of degrees, the fish begin to experience a small change in their behavior, causing them to become 30 times more aggressive and more active.

Although many people doubt about the personality of animals, the results of these studies are surprising, and it has become known that each animal has a specific personality and that this can depend largely on the factors to which they are subject. and to environmental changes in their natural habitat.
